The CJEU strikes down the European Parliament's decision to suspend the immunity of Puigdemont, Comín, and Ponsatí

The EU Court of Justice annuls the European Parliament's decision that withdrew immunity from Puigdemont, Comín and Ponsatí, considering that the procedure violated the principle of impartiality

The Court of Justice of the European Union (CJEU) has annulled this Thursday the decision adopted in 2021 by the European Parliament to withdraw parliamentary immunity from the former president of the Generalitat Carles Puigdemont and former MEPs Toni Comín and Clara Ponsatí, considering that the procedure violated the principle of impartiality. The ruling, which represents a setback for the European Parliament and for those who promoted the suspension of their privileges, comes after years of legal battle in European institutions
